1. Introduction: Understanding the Charm of Grid Trading#
Grid trading is an automated strategy that captures market volatility by setting buy and sell points within a predetermined price range. In the cryptocurrency market, this strategy is particularly suitable for highly volatile environments. 5. Setting Grid Trading Parameters#
- Select Trading Pair: In Grid Trading Bot, choose the trading pairs supported by Binance, such as BTC-USDT, ETH-BTC, etc.
- Set Price Range: Analyze the market and determine the upper and lower price limits to ensure sufficient volatility.
- Set Grid Quantity: Decide how many grids to create within the price range, usually 5-10 grids.
- Set Buy/Sell Quantity: Determine the buy and sell quantity for each grid, which can be allocated proportionally or fixed.
- Set Trading Fees: Consider Binance's trading fees to ensure profitability of the strategy.
- Choose Trading Mode: Choose between fixed price difference or dynamic price difference mode.

7. Frequently Asked Questions and Notes#
- Risk Management: Set stop-loss points to avoid significant losses during market fluctuations.
- Market Analysis: Grid trading is suitable for volatile markets but not for trending markets.
- Monitoring and Adjustment: Regularly check the effectiveness of the trades and adjust strategies based on market changes.
